Item: Red Breastplate of Beastly Forms:

In areas with many enchanters, some stylized items may actually hold more power and purpose than what they originally appear to have.  One example is the Red Breastplate of Beastly Forms.

Item: Red Breastplate of Beastly Forms (15 lbs) (Rare) (Excellent) (21 GP, 186 CP) (2 Toughness) (4 EP) (Shape Change, Animal Tongue, Speech Retention): This steel breastplate has been passed through the bluing process to be black, but engraved runes and animal depictions of a fox, phoenix, and squid, have been put into the breastplate in a copper and iron mixture to give it a more noticeable red percentage of the surface.  It is said that the creator of this and other enchanted armor pieces created it, there were other colored sets and other types of armor belonging to each set, though none have publicly displayed more than two pieces at a time per colored set.  Perhaps the rumors are just that, or perhaps the pieces are too scattered to have a full set.  When one wears the breastplate it does offer a fair amount of use simply as armor, but in addition it allows the wearer to use an activation phrase to morph into one of the three animals, as well as retain not only their own language to speak in, but that of the animal they have morphed into.  In order to resume their natural form, however, they need to speak a different phrase to change back.  While in animal form they must not lose the breastplate, now reshaped to fit their new form, or they will be unable to speak their normal form or return back until they get it back or have assistance from other means.  These limitations have been used by shifty individuals in the past to not only get rid of enemies or prey, but also to gain byproducts from those creatures to sell.  Let the buyer beware, should they fail to ensure they have the proper phrase to change back...
